Toilet Clearing in Denver, CO
Toilet clearing services involve removing blockages and obstructions that prevent toilets from flushing properly or cause backups. This service covers a variety of projects, including resolving minor clogs caused by everyday waste, addressing more stubborn or recurring blockages, and clearing obstructions in the drain pipes that lead to the toilet. Property owners typically request this service when a toilet is slow to drain, overflows during use, or remains clogged despite using household plungers or chemical drain cleaners. It is important to understand the nature of the clog, the age and condition of the toilet, and any previous issues to ensure the most effective solution.
Before requesting toilet clearing services, homeowners should consider whether the clog is isolated or part of a larger drainage problem. They may also want to know if the blockage is caused by foreign objects, buildup, or structural issues within the plumbing system. Providing details about the duration of the problem, any recent repairs, or unusual odors can help determine the appropriate approach. Clear communication about the symptoms and history of the issue can assist in selecting the right service to restore proper toilet function efficiently.

Toilet Clearing Questions
What causes a toilet to become clogged? Common causes include excessive toilet paper, foreign objects, or buildup in the pipes.
How can I tell if my toilet is blocked? Signs include slow drainage, gurgling sounds, or water backing up in the bowl.
Is it possible to clear a toilet clog without professional help? Minor clogs may be cleared with a plunger, but persistent blockages often require specialized tools.
What should I avoid doing if my toilet is clogged? Avoid using chemical drain cleaners or flushing foreign objects to prevent damage or worsening the clog.
